| GPU Snapshot | |||
| Release date: | Oct 22, 2010 | Price at Launch: | $179 |
| Type: | Desktop | Architecture: | VLIW5 (Barts Pro) |
| Generation: | Radeon HD 6000 series | Product Tier: | Midrange |
| VRAM Capacity: | 1 GB | Total Board Power: | 127 W |
| Core Configuration | |||
| Shader Cores: | 960 | TMUs: | 48 |
| ROPs: | 32 | L2 Cache: | 512 KB |
| Memory | |||
| VRAM Capacity: | 1 GB | Memory Type: | GDDR5 |
| Memory Speed: | 4 Gbps | Memory Bus: | 256-bit |
| Bandwidth: | 128 GB/s | ||
| Graphics Processing | |||
| Base Clock: | 0.775 GHz | FP32 Throughput: | 1.49 TFLOPs |
| Ray Tracing: | No | Process Size: | 40nm |
| Process Name: | TSMC 40nm | Die Size: | 255 mm² |
| Power & Connectivity | |||
| Total Board Power: | 127 W | Power Connectors: | 1x 6-pin |
| Bus Interface: | PCIe 2.0x16 | HDMI Support: | HDMI 1.3a |
| DisplayPort Support: | Mini-DP 1.2 | DSC: | No |
| Max Displays: | 4 | ||
| Media & Software Support | |||
| DirectX Support: | 11.2 | Shader Model: | 5.0 |
| OpenGL Version: | 4.4 | ||
